What must it have felt like to grow up as a child prodigy, travelling across Europe for years in a carriage with Dad, Mum and sister Nannerl instead of going to school like ordinary children...? In a lively, interactive and very funny programme, Andreas Peer Kähler and the Kammerorchester Unter den Linden - aided by the magic wig and with plenty of audience participation - guide visitors through the extraordinary life of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art. The soloist is 12-year-old Maria Elisabeth Lange, violin.
Suitable from age 5 - 70 min.
At every concert, three children can win a Musical Picture Book from Annette Betz Verlag!
After the concert, visitors can try out instruments from the Klingendes Museum in the foyer, with expert guidance on hand.
